I just saw Kirsten Dunst showed up to watch a screening of Bring It On with a crowd this weekend and made me also think Bring It On should be on this list.

$68M in 2000 but I feel it's stayed relevant like Mean Girls.

Pitch Perfect 1 had a similar original box office tally before jumping to $184,296,230 with #2 and I feel like Bring It On can probably have a Twisters/TGM type reboot that would still work with today's generation. A $200M+ tally wouldn't be shocking.

Cobra Kai also just feels like a retread of the same type of story but with Karate so think audiences are still very much into this type of sports competition story they would just need to get the cast right and get Dunst and Union back.

How about Small Soldiers? A decent hit with an easily repetable premise of a more cynical Toy Story. And had a breakthrough actress in Dunst. I guess maybe the whole "Phil Hartman got murdered by his wife shortly before the movie opened" made production on a sequel a bit too macbre.
